Intermittent electromechanical dissociation following mitral valve replacement with mechanical valve: a different
Deepak Gopakumar1, Bineesh Kundoly Radhakrishnan1, Thomas Koshy2
1Department of CVTS, SCTIMST, Thiruvananthapuram, Kerala India.
A patient experienced electromechanical dissociation after mitral valve replacement. A torn suture caused prosthetic valve dysfunction, successfully treated by suture removal and recovery.

Background:
- Mitral valve replacement with papillary muscle resuspension is a complex procedure.
- Prosthetic valve dysfunction can arise from various mechanical complications.
- Electromechanical dissociation is a rare but critical condition requiring prompt diagnosis.
Observation:
- A 62-year-old male developed intermittent electromechanical dissociation post-mitral valve replacement.
- Transesophageal echocardiography revealed extrinsic prosthetic valve dysfunction.
- A torn pledgeted suture from papillary muscle resuspension was identified as the cause.
Findings:
- The torn suture lodged between the prosthetic valve's disc occluder and valve ring.
- This mechanical obstruction led to the observed prosthetic valve dysfunction and electromechanical dissociation.
- Surgical removal of the offending suture resolved the complication.
Implications:
- This case underscores the critical role of advanced imaging in diagnosing unusual prosthetic valve failures.
- Vigilant monitoring is essential for early detection of rare complications after cardiac surgery.
- Careful surgical technique and material selection are paramount to prevent suture-related complications.
